1052, 1127 and 1157 barrels are all interchangeable, Dot head will fit all of them too, obviously need to use the correct chain / sprockets to suit the crank.

However, 1052 has 1mm shorter stroke, so barrels are shorter which conversely means if you were to put 1127 barrels on a 1052 crank, you'll lose compression and open up the squish band, robbing you of performance.

I guess you could get the barrels "decked" to shave 1mm off them, but they might be difficult to sell on if you ever wanted to, as a set of 1127 barrels that are only 58mm stroke might not find many buyers.

This is not correct. All barrels for 1052 cc 1127 cc and 1157 cc have the same heigth. The length of the conrods for 1052 cc are 117.4 mm, and 1127 cc and 1157 cc are 117.0 mm. Therefore, the squish height for 1052 cc is 0.1 mm larger compared to the 1127 cc and 1157 cc engines (theoretlically) .

The DOT head for GSXR 750 -88/89 are equal to the GSX750F. The difference is the camshafts. GSX750F has shorter duration and lower lift compared to GSXR 750.

The DOT head comes with higher valve spring stiffness compared to the 1052 cc 1127 cc and 1157 cc engines. The rev limiter is higher for GSXR 750 -88/89 and GSX750F compared to 1052 cc, 1127 cc and 1157 cc engines. The valve stiffness for the DOT head is equal to the Yoshimura valve spring kit for ST-2 cams. The valve springs for the DOT head needs to be shimmed to get the correct seat pressure.

Correct but the 750 spring cannot be used with the ST2 10mm lift cams as they will coil bind
